Rare Woobstr112G Posted February 4, 2011 Author #54 Share Posted February 4, 2011 Good morning to all from the Golden Princess. It’s a little after 0600 on our second day at sea. Yesterday was a nice day at sea. The weather was a little overcast and there was some noticeable movement. It wasn’t that bad though. The Golden Princess continues to impress me. Very clean ship and very friendly crew. There were tons of Hawaiian activities throughout the day. We had our meet and greet yesterday in the Wheelhouse bar. It was well attended and was nice to put faces to people we had been talking to online. I made good use of the gym yesterday. The equipment was in good order and I only had to wait for a few minutes for a treadmill to open up. I also did several fast walk laps around the promenade deck. After working out. I had a light breakfast in the Horizon court. It was very crowded and I ended up taking my food back to our cabin. For lunch I had a tasty hamburger at the trident grill. This is always a favorite spot for me. We had late seating traditional dining in the Donatello dining room. It was “North American” themed night. The food was quite good. I especially enjoyed the baked Oyster appetizer I had. It was very tasty. Yesterday’s movie schedule consisted of From here to eternity (MUTS) at 1000, Letters to Juliet (MUTS) 1230, Oceans (MUTS) at 1500, Waiting for superman (MUTS) 1900 & 2200. The Passion band played in Explorers, the Ruben Café Quintet performed in the Wheelhouse bar, Stardust was the production show in the theater, there was big band dancing in the vista lounge. Later in the Vista ventriloquist Gareth Oliver performed. Tonight is our first formal night. As soon as I get back from the gym, I will be trying on my rental tux to make sure it fits. Internet service is slow but I’m always able to get connected. Thank goodness for being able to compose offline in word before I post otherwise I’d be out of minutes already. Rare Woobstr112G Posted February 5, 2011 Author #66 Share Posted February 5, 2011 Good morning all from the Golden Princess. Today is another leisurely day at sea. Tomorrow is our last sea day before we hit Hilo. Last night was our first formal night. I was surprised at the number of Tuxedos I saw. There were also many men in dark suits as well. The champagne waterfall was well attended and everyone seemed to have a great time. Our dinner was also very good. Our waiter and assistant waiter do a good job in making sure we have a nice dining experience. I did notice that the Canaletto dining room seemed a little empty. I also noted while walking to dinner that Sabatini’s was quite full and many of the dinner guests were decked out in formal wear. DW had a massage in the Lotus Spa and loved it. So much so, that she booked another one for next week. She told me that she was offered the opportunity to purchase some items but added that it really wasn’t a hard sell. During the early afternoon (yesterday) there were several cool demonstrations held in the Piazza. Watched a cool martini demo along with a vegetable carving/sushi demo. After the demos, they had a sushi buffet around the calypso pool. After dinner we went to the vista lounge and saw ventriloquist Gareth Oliver. Gareth was a semi finalist on the British version of America’s got talent. He was very funny and did a great show. Just a hint, if you go to a comedian or other good show in the vista lounge go early to get a seat. It fills up very fast to standing room only. Today’s entertainment consists of Pearl Harbor (MUTS) at 0900, Killers (MUTS) at 1500, and The Social Network (MUTS) at 1900/2200. In the Piazza there is music by the Rubin Café Quintet, and Cube spinning & Balance. Illusionist Alexander is on tap for the princess theater, while harmonica virtuoso Bernie Fields is on tap for the vista lounge. Rare Woobstr112G Posted February 6, 2011 Author #71 Share Posted February 6, 2011 Good morning from the Golden Princess. Today is our final sea day before we hit Hawaii. It is also Super Bowl Sunday. The game will be broadcast on MUTS and in all public lounges. Unfortunately the type of public license they have from the NFL prohibits broadcast in the individual cabins. Yesterday was another great day at sea. I made good use of the gym in the early morning and then just hung out for the rest of the day. Still having the pesky problem of my Princess Visa being declined for authorization despite several calls to Barclays who assured me all fraud protection holds were lifted. The food in the MDR continues to impress me. The variety and quality continue to be very good to excellent. I even have several cups of (:eek:) syrup coffee with my meal. The deserts are quite tasty. Haven’t tried Sabatinis or the Crown grill yet. Hopefully will be doing at least the CG on the way back from Hawaii. I did have one bit of good news in our table head waiter did some checking and found we were selected for the second chef’s table on the night we leave Maui headed to Ensenada. I am totally stoked. Last night we saw illusionist Alexander in the Princess theater. We had no trouble finding a great seat close to the stage. Movies shown yesterday were Pearl Harbor (MUTS) at 0900, Killers (MUTS) at 1500, The Social Network at 1900/2200 hrs. Piazza entertainment consisted of Musical melodies of the Ruben Café Quintet, and Cube Spinning & Balance. There were also several Hawaiian themed classes along with computer classes offered via the scholarship@sea program. I’ve been impressed so far at the quantity and variety of classes offered under the scholarship@sea program. Nothing much planned for today except watching the Super Bowl somewhere on the ship. Tomorrow in Hilo we are taking a ship sponsored excursion to see some volcanoes. This excursion is the one that only skirts the lava tube.
